Aquarius and Scorpio Compatibility

Heat and coolness often attract: Aquarius’s intellectual detachment can magnetize Scorpio’s emotional intensity because each admires what the other lacks. This introduction focuses on attraction-first dynamics, showing why intrigue sparks fast between these two fixed signs and how fascination can become the relationship’s engine.

Aquarius brings unconventional ideals and social breadth, while Scorpio offers emotional depth and transformative loyalty. Their fixed modality means both move with similar persistence, so initial magnetism has follow-through — but the same persistence can lock them into repeated miscommunications unless they build deliberate repair habits.

Love Compatibility

Explanation: Sexual and romantic chemistry begins with curiosity; Aquarius admires Scorpio’s emotional courage, while Scorpio values the novelty and breadth Aquarius brings. That initial intrigue often feels magnetic because each projects a missing quality onto the other.

Example: On a first few dates, Aquarius might lure Scorpio into conversations about causes and ideas, while Scorpio responds with confessions that deepen the connection. This mix produces intense bonding sessions that feel revelatory for both partners.

Consequence: Without translating admiration into agreed boundaries, Scorpio’s need for exclusivity can clash with Aquarius’s need for space. Over time this mismatch can turn fascination into frustration unless they verbalize what exclusivity and independence actually look like in day-to-day life.

Communication Compatibility

Scenario: A disagreement about plans escalates when Aquarius calmly analyzes options while Scorpio probes for hidden motives. The same fixed pacing means neither rushes away, but both can bunker into their preferred modes.

Analysis: Aquarius approaches talk as a conceptual, objective exchange; Scorpio treats conversation as a tool for truth and emotional probing. Because both can become stubborn, arguments may become standoffs where each expects the other to change first.

Recommendation: Create a communication habit that pairs Aquarius’s clarity with Scorpio’s depth. For example, agree that Scorpio can ask one direct emotional question and Aquarius will answer without turning it into debate; follow with a pause so Scorpio feels heard and Aquarius keeps autonomy.

Emotional Compatibility

Strength: Both partners can sustain loyalty — Aquarius through principles and Scorpio through devotion — so emotional bonds can become durable when needs are spelled out.

Weakness: Aquarius tends to process feelings intellectually and requires space, while Scorpio seeks private intensity and visible proof of commitment; this difference can make Aquarius seem distant precisely when Scorpio needs reassurance.

Application: Use rituals that satisfy both needs: a weekly debrief that allows Aquarius to think aloud and Scorpio to express depth, plus an agreed physical gesture (a shared calendar event or nightly check-in) that signals availability without smothering.

Friendship Compatibility

Explanation: Friendship-first bonding can be a reliable bridge; Aquarius offers inclusive ideals, and Scorpio keeps confidences, so social activism or shared projects often become safe places to connect.

Example: When they volunteer together for a cause, Aquarius sparks ideas and Scorpio nails logistics and commitment. That teamwork creates mutual admiration rooted in visible output rather than verbal promises.

Consequence: If friendship stays strictly project-based without emotional check-ins, Scorpio may feel the partnership lacks intimacy and Aquarius may mistake steady collaboration for emotional closeness. They benefit from occasional private time that separates social engagement from personal closeness.

Dating Dynamics

On a first date, Aquarius steers conversation toward social causes and unusual ideas, while Scorpio gradually reveals personal stories. The mix sparks fascination; if Aquarius shows sincere curiosity and Scorpio resists immediate testing, a seed of trust will form.

Texting Styles

Aquarius texts with concept-driven updates and occasional aloofness; Scorpio prefers steady, emotionally attuned messages. They should agree on responsiveness expectations: Aquarius can flag busy periods and Scorpio can avoid interpretive probes during silences.

Conflict Patterns

During conflict, Scorpio investigates motives and may demand proofs; Aquarius analyzes and retreats into principle. A useful tactic is a brief timeout followed by a structured check-in where each names a need and an observable assurance that calms the other.

Money and Stability

Financial decisions work best when Aquarius frames goals and Scorpio manages risk and detail. Joint budgets should divide visionary planning from practical safeguards, with scheduled reviews to avoid unilateral choices.

Living Together

Living together reveals daily rhythms: Aquarius needs corners of personal autonomy, Scorpio needs private zones to process intensity. Agree on shared spaces, alone times, and a protocol for emotional check-ins before bed.

Marriage Compatibility

Scenario: Married life highlights contrast — Aquarius wants autonomy and a social life, while Scorpio expects deep exclusivity and integrated private life. Fixed persistence helps both keep promises, but expectations must be negotiated.

Analysis: Practical household routines suit both when they reflect agreed principles: Aquarius structures freedoms around shared values and Scorpio ensures emotional reliability through consistent private rituals.

Recommendation: Draft a living plan that outlines social boundaries, privacy rules, and conflict protocols. For example, agree on how to handle invitations, private time, and when to escalate concerns so each partner’s sense of safety remains intact.

What Makes This Match Work (Green Flags)

They follow through on commitments: Fixed timing helps promises land reliably, which builds trust over months and years.

Shared projects or causes often bind them: working together reorients their differences into complementary strengths rather than competition.

Both value loyalty in their way: Aquarius expresses it through intellectual consistency and presence, Scorpio through protection and emotional investment.

Relationship Advice

Start with transparency about needs: Scorpio should name what counts as proof of loyalty, and Aquarius should explain how much independence they require and what signals reassure them.

Develop concrete repair habits: set a timeout language for when conversations become testing, then schedule a calm debrief with rules for curiosity and non-accusation to prevent cycles of withdrawal and investigation.

Translate ideals into behaviors: make clear agreements about exclusivity, social boundaries, and daily rituals so Scorpio’s need for closeness and Aquarius’s desire for freedom can coexist without guessing.

FAQ

Can Aquarius and Scorpio have a trusting relationship?

Yes, Aquarius and Scorpio can build trust, but it requires deliberate translation between emotional languages. Scorpio builds trust through consistent emotional truth and private devotion, while Aquarius trusts when autonomy and ideas receive respect. That means Scorpio should offer concrete, predictable signs of loyalty (shared rituals, reliability in crisis) and Aquarius should state limits and be present in ways that feel meaningful to Scorpio. Over time, mutual consistency — not assumptions — creates safety.

How should Aquarius handle Scorpio’s intensity without losing independence?

Aquarius can maintain independence by establishing clear boundaries and naming what emotional availability looks like in practice. Rather than withdrawing silently, try stating intentions: say when you need solitude and how long it will last. Pair that with small, consistent reassurances that matter to Scorpio, such as a nightly message or a planned activity together. These concrete gestures let Scorpio feel protected without requiring Aquarius to compromise core freedom.

What communication habits help this pair avoid repeating the same fights?

Create structured repair routines that respect both partners’ styles. For example, agree on a cooling-off signal and a scheduled debrief within 24–48 hours where each person names one need and one actionable assurance. Scorpio should avoid investigative tactics that escalate suspicion; Aquarius should resist turning emotional requests into abstract debates. Use a simple checklist: emotional claim, concrete request, and one observable gesture to demonstrate follow-through.

Are Aquarius and Scorpio sexually compatible?

Sexual chemistry often appears intense because Scorpio’s depth meets Aquarius’s inventive approach. Scorpio seeks transformative closeness, while Aquarius craves novelty and intellectual equality. The best encounters combine emotional trust-building (slow vulnerability from Scorpio) with experimental play and mental connection from Aquarius. Establishing safety — through honest talk about desires and boundaries — helps physical intimacy mature into a satisfying, evolving sexual relationship.

Should Aquarius and Scorpio live together early in a relationship?

Moving in early can reveal mismatches quickly because daily routines force differences into the open: Scorpio’s desire for privacy and rituals may collide with Aquarius’s need for autonomy and social fluidity. If they consider cohabitation, set trial periods with explicit agreements about alone time, guest policies, and emotional check-ins. These practical rules reduce misunderstandings and let both evaluate whether household life supports their distinct needs.

What role do shared causes and projects play in sustaining this relationship?

Shared causes often become the relationship’s glue. Aquarius thrives on ideal-driven collaboration, and Scorpio contributes focused execution and loyalty. When the couple channels energy into activism, research, or a joint project, they translate differing strengths into visible outcomes. That public teamwork reduces personal pressure and fosters mutual respect; over time, shared accomplishments create a track record of reliability that eases Scorpio’s trust concerns and satisfies Aquarius’s drive for meaningful contribution.

How can Scorpio stop testing boundaries without feeling unsafe?

Scorpio can reduce testing by asking for reassurance in explicit, manageable ways rather than using covert tests. For instance, request a shared plan for Friday nights or a short check-in when apart. Pair such requests with agreed indicators of trust — like keeping promises or transparent scheduling — so Scorpio receives evidence without creating surveillance. Over time, concrete assurances replace the urge to probe and rebuild a safer pattern of connection.
